Job Title: IT and Security System Technical Support
Job Duties: To install, maintain and repair IT systems, security and surveillance systems. You will be the one to ensure that adequate IT infrastructure is in place and is used to its maximum capabilities. • Set up hardware and install and configure software and drivers • Maintain and repair computer and security equipments (e.g. CCTV Cameras) or peripheral devices • Install well-functioning LAN/WAN and other networks and manage components. • Perform regular upgrades to ensure systems remain updated. • Troubleshoot system failures or bugs and provide solutions to restore functionality. • Arrange maintenance sessions to discover and mend inefficiencies. • Keep records of repairs and fixes for future reference • Offer timely technical support and teach users how to utilize the computer and security systems correctly.
High School Diploma Required? Undetermined
Qualification Requirements: • Proven experience as computer, security and surveillance technical support or similar role. • Experience with LAN/WAN networks. • Knowledge in IP surveillance system highly preferred. • Thorough knowledge of computer systems and IT components • Excellent troubleshooting skills. • Very good communication abilities. • Exceptional organizing and time-management skills. • Diploma in any Technology related field or equivalent work experience required. • Relevant certifications (e.g. CompTIA A+) will be an advantage. Title Job Zone Three: Medium Preparation Needed Education Most occupations in this zone require training in vocational schools, related on-the-job experience, or an associate's degree. Related Experience Previous work-related skill, knowledge, or experience is required for these occupations. For example, an electrician must have completed three or four years of apprenticeship or several years of vocational training, and often must have passed a licensing exam, in order to perform the job. Job Training Employees in these occupations usually need one or two years of training involving both on-the-job experience and informal training with experienced workers. A recognized apprenticeship program may be associated with these occupations. Job Zone Examples These occupations usually involve using communication and organizational skills to coordinate, supervise, manage, or train others to accomplish goals. Examples include hydroelectric production managers, travel guides, electricians, agricultural technicians, barbers, nannies, and medical assistants. SVP Range (6.0 to < 7.0)
